ICT as a Public Participation Tool for Women Empowerment: An Overview From Kudumbashree, Kerala, India
Abstract
Public participation is considered one of the most popular initiatives in the process of any regional development. The empowerment of women with respect to different laws, legislation, and schemes is considered an important concern of the 21st century in a developing country, like India. While focusing on socio-economic development with women's empowerment, the promotion of ICT in women's participation is still very limited. In public participation towards women empowerment in Kerala, a government initiative project, Kudumbashree, has been adopted for the analysis of this research to tackle spatial divides and socio-economic inequalities in the research area, whereas the stakeholder (women) shows limited information towards participation, which could be a challenge. Therefore, this chapter, emphasizes the contribution of ICT as an effective tool for public participation in women's empowerment in Kerala. It is used to critically analyze and discuss the importance of ICT in women's participation for their empowerment in the process of development of the region.
